CVE-2024-48862: QuLog Center

Published Nov 22, 2024
·
Updated

A link following vulnerability has been reported to affect QuLog Center. If exploited, the vulnerability could allow remote attackers to traverse the file system to unintended locations and read or overwrite the contents of unexpected files.

We have already fixed the vulnerability in the following versions: QuLog Center 1.7.0.831 ( 2024/10/15 ) and later QuLog Center 1.8.0.888 ( 2024/10/15 ) and later

Affected Software

3 affected components
QuLog Center<1.7.0.831, <1.8.0.888
QNAP QuLog Center>=1.7.0.800<1.7.0.831
QNAP QuLog Center>=1.8.0.872<1.8.0.888
